One of my batteries failed in the middle of doing the firmware upgrade the center 2 LED's are stuck on.  Tried letting the battery sit for 2 hours.  Pressing the button does nothing, tried charging the battery after 3 hours still does the samething.  Spark is two weeks old and it looks like one of my batteries is toast.  Any ideas or am I looking at sending this one back?

Thx for any help. Already put a request into DJI for help as well.

It is the sign that the battery had not upgraded successfully. please try to connect the drone with this battery to DJI Assistant 2 and see if you can upgrade it again.
If you can not upgrade it again, please connect the drone to DJI Assistant 2 with another battery and export the upgrade log from Black Box. Besides, please send the battery back and we will take care of this. Thank you.
